How do you get the iPad 1 to play music

I recently bought an iPad 1. I synced it up w/iTunes on my iMac.

For some reason, I can't get any of the music that was synced to play on my iPad? Do you need to download iTunes or an App to play music on the iPad?

When you synced your iPad, did you then open the actual device (click on the device on the left hand side)? Then when the device is open, you go up to music and check the songs/albums you want to sync to the iPad. The music will then appear in your iPod app, which is native to the iPad. You open the iPod and your synced music should be there and easily played. If that is not the case, let us know.
